Antique Broken Arch Top Harlequin Highboy for Restoration

About the Item

A very well made Highboy with fine traditional form, dove-tail drawer construction, later Batwing pulls and escutcheons, top turned Finials, two deep square drawers with Scalloped carving and resting on delicately curved Cabriolet legs. In total there are twelve drawers. The Highboy was involved in a fire in the early 20th Century and the refinishing work was halted midstream resulting in what has turned out to be a very interesting Harlequin presentation with some drawers in a tiger maple stain and the frame and other drawers in a deep mahogany stain. While restoration is a possibility, it is not strongly recommended as the piece is interesting and quite decorative the way it now stands. Dimensions: 77.5” high by 39.25” wide by 18” deep. Condition: Please see detail photos. There are various signs of age including stable age cracks, finish losses and rubs to the finish, a circular indent on the bottom drawer of the top unit and finish losses to the pulls and escutcheons. The escutcheons are false as there are no locks. As stated, despite the wear and condition, the Highboy presents in a singular and very decorative manner.
